Are you looking for a job as an AZ driver in Brampton and Mississauga? If so, you’ve come to the right place. The Greater Toronto Area (GTA) is one of the largest urban areas in Canada and is a great place to look for AZ driver jobs. Brampton and Mississauga are two of the most popular cities in the GTA for AZ driver jobs. Brampton and Mississauga are two of the largest cities in the GTA and offer many job opportunities for AZ drivers. The city of Brampton is home to many large companies and has a thriving industrial sector. This means that AZ drivers can find plenty of job opportunities in Brampton. Meanwhile, Mississauga is a major hub for freight transportation in the GTA. It is home to many major freight companies and is a great place for AZ drivers to find employment. When looking for AZ driver jobs in Brampton and Mississauga, it is important to be aware of the requirements for the job. Most companies will require you to have a valid AZ driver’s license and to have a good driving record. Additionally, you may need to pass a background check and drug test in order to be considered for the job. It is also important to be aware of the working conditions for AZ driver jobs in Brampton and Mississauga. Many of these jobs involve long hours and can be physically demanding. It is important to make sure that you are comfortable with the job and that you are able to handle the physical demands of the job. Finally, it is important to do your research when looking for AZ driver jobs in Brampton and Mississauga. There are many different companies that offer AZ driver jobs in the area and it is important to find one that is a good fit for you. Make sure to read reviews and talk to other AZ drivers in the area to get an idea of what the job is like. Finding an AZ driver job in Brampton and Mississauga can be a great way to make a living. With the right preparation and research, you can find a great job that suits your needs and will provide you with a good income.

Canada is a land of opportunities, and finding a job here can be a life-changing experience for people looking to start a new career or advance their professional goals. However, the job market in Canada can be competitive, and knowing where to look for jobs can make a significant difference in your chances of success. In this article, we will explore the best places to look for jobs in Canada, including online job boards, company websites, recruitment agencies, networking events, and other resources that can help you find your dream job. 1. Online job boards Online job boards are one of the most popular and convenient ways of looking for jobs in Canada. These websites list job openings from various industries and companies, making it easy for job seekers to browse through different opportunities and apply to those that match their skills and experience. Some of the top online job boards in Canada include Indeed.ca, Monster.ca, Workopolis.com, and Jobbank.gc.ca. These websites allow you to create a profile, upload your resume, and apply to job postings with just a few clicks. You can also set up job alerts to receive notifications when new jobs that match your criteria are posted. 2. Company websites Many companies in Canada post job openings on their own websites, making it easy for job seekers to apply directly to the company. This is especially useful if you are interested in working for a specific company or industry. To find job openings on a company's website, look for a "careers" or "jobs" section on their homepage. You can also use search engines like Google to find job openings on a company's website by typing in "company name + jobs" or "company name + careers." 3. Recruitment agencies Recruitment agencies are companies that help connect job seekers with employers. These agencies work with various companies and industries and can help you find job openings that match your skills and experience. Some of the top recruitment agencies in Canada include Adecco, Kelly Services, Randstad, and Robert Half. These agencies typically require you to submit your resume and complete an interview process before they can match you with job openings. 4. Networking events Networking events are a great way to meet people in your industry and learn about job openings that may not be posted online. These events can include industry conferences, job fairs, and meetups. To find networking events in your industry, check online event calendars, industry association websites, and social media groups. You can also reach out to people in your industry and ask them about upcoming events. 5. Social media Social media platforms like LinkedIn, Twitter, and Facebook can be helpful in finding job openings and connecting with people in your industry. Many companies and recruiters post job openings on their social media pages, and you can also use social media to network with people in your industry and learn about job openings through word of mouth. To use social media for job searching, create a professional profile that highlights your skills and experience. You can also join industry groups and follow companies and recruiters in your industry to stay up-to-date on job postings. 6. Government resources The Canadian government offers various resources to help job seekers find employment. Job Bank is a government-run website that lists job openings across Canada, and also offers career planning tools and job market information. Other government resources include Employment and Social Development Canada (ESDC), which provides information on employment standards, labour laws, and workplace health and safety, and Service Canada, which offers employment insurance, training programs, and job search assistance. 7. Professional associations Professional associations are organizations that represent people in specific industries or professions. These associations can be a valuable resource for job seekers, as they often have job boards, networking events, and other resources that can help you find job openings and advance your career. To find professional associations in your industry, check online directories or ask people in your industry for recommendations. You can also use search engines to find associations by typing in "industry name + association." In conclusion, there are many resources available to help you find jobs in Canada, and it's important to use a combination of these resources to increase your chances of success. By using online job boards, company websites, recruitment agencies, networking events, and other resources, you can find job openings that match your skills and experience and take your career to the next level.

If you are looking for a part-time job to earn some extra cash or to gain work experience, McDonald's can be a great option. With over 38,000 locations worldwide and more than 1.7 million employees, McDonald's is one of the largest fast-food chains in the world. Getting a job at McDonald's can be a great opportunity for anyone who wants to start their career in the food industry, gain valuable experience in customer service, and learn important skills like teamwork, communication, and time management. In this article, we will guide you on how to get a job at McDonald's, from the application process to the interview, and share some tips and tricks to help you land the job. Step 1: Research the job requirements Before you start applying for a job at McDonald's, you need to know the job requirements. McDonald's offers a wide range of job positions, from crew members to shift managers, and each position has different requirements. For example, crew members are responsible for taking orders, preparing food, and cleaning the restaurant, while shift managers are responsible for supervising the crew, managing inventory, and ensuring the restaurant runs smoothly. To find out more about the job requirements, you can visit the McDonald's website or check out job listing sites like Indeed or Glassdoor. You can also visit your local McDonald's restaurant and ask for information about job openings and requirements. Step 2: Prepare your application Once you know the job requirements, you can start preparing your application. The first step is to create a resume that highlights your skills and experience. Even if you don't have any previous work experience, you can include information about your education, volunteer work, or any other relevant experience. Your resume should include your contact information, education, work experience, skills, and achievements. Make sure to tailor your resume to the job position you are applying for and highlight your strengths and qualifications. In addition to your resume, you will also need to fill out an online application form on the McDonald's website. The application form will ask for your personal information, work experience, education, and availability. Make sure to fill out the form accurately and honestly, and double-check for any errors before submitting. Step 3: Prepare for the interview After submitting your application, you may be invited for an interview. The interview is your chance to showcase your personality, communication skills, and motivation to work at McDonald's. It's important to prepare for the interview to make a good impression and increase your chances of getting the job. Here are some tips to help you prepare for the interview: 1. Research the company: Learn more about McDonald's history, values, and mission statement. This will show the interviewer that you are interested in the company and motivated to work there. 2. Dress appropriately: Dress in a clean and professional manner, even if the dress code at McDonald's is casual. Avoid wearing anything too revealing or distracting. 3. Practice common interview questions: Prepare answers to common interview questions like "Why do you want to work at McDonald's?" or "What are your strengths and weaknesses?" Practice your answers with a friend or family member to feel more confident. 4. Be on time: Arrive at the interview location at least 10-15 minutes early to avoid being late. This will show the interviewer that you are punctual and reliable. 5. Bring a copy of your resume: Bring a copy of your resume to the interview to refer to if needed. This will also show the interviewer that you are prepared and organized. Step 4: Ace the interview During the interview, it's important to be confident, friendly, and professional. Here are some tips to help you ace the interview: 1. Smile and make eye contact: Greet the interviewer with a smile and make eye contact to show that you are friendly and confident. 2. Listen carefully and ask questions: Listen carefully to the interviewer's questions and answer them thoughtfully. Ask questions about the job position and the company to show your interest. 3. Highlight your skills and experience: Use examples from your previous work experience or education to showcase your skills and experience. This will help the interviewer understand how you can contribute to the company. 4. Be enthusiastic: Show your enthusiasm for the job and the company by expressing your interest in the position and the industry. 5. Follow up: After the interview, send a thank-you email or note to the interviewer to show your appreciation for the opportunity. Step 5: Complete the onboarding process If you are offered a job at McDonald's, you will need to complete the onboarding process before starting your job. The onboarding process includes filling out paperwork, attending training sessions, and completing a background check. During the training sessions, you will learn about the company's policies, procedures, and expectations. You will also receive training on customer service, food preparation, and safety protocols. It's important to take the training seriously and ask questions if you need clarification. Once you have completed the onboarding process, you will be ready to start your job at McDonald's. As a new employee, it's important to be punctual, reliable, and committed to providing excellent customer service. With hard work and dedication, you can build a successful career at McDonald's and gain valuable experience that will help you in your future career endeavors. Conclusion Getting a job at McDonald's can be a great opportunity for anyone who wants to start their career in the food industry or gain valuable work experience. By following these steps, you can increase your chances of landing the job and starting your career at McDonald's. Remember to be prepared, confident, and enthusiastic during the application and interview process, and to take the training seriously once you are hired. With dedication and hard work, you can build a successful career at McDonald's and achieve your career goals.
